Like Lionel Messi and Marco Verratti, Bondy’s crack appeared on the Camp des Loges lawn for the first 15 minutes of the day’s session.

Will Kylian Mbappé be present for the round of 16 first leg of the Champions League for Paris Saint-Germain on Tuesday (9 p.m.) against Bayern Munich? The training of Christophe Galtier’s players, this Monday morning on the eve of the match, suggests a certain optimism. Mbappé entered the pitch well with the rest of his teammates for the start of training, the first 15 minutes of which are broadcast live by PSG on its official website and via its social networks. Same thing for Lionel Messi, Marco Verratti and Fabian Ruiz absent during the defeat to Monaco on Sunday (3-1), or even Presnel Kimpembe, who returned to the Principality after three months away from the pitch. No worries for Nuno Mendes, Sergio Ramos and Achraf Hakimi, substitutes at kick-off against ASM. A priori, the only absentees are called Nordi Mukiele and Renato Sanches.

Victim of a lesion of the left thigh at the level of the biceps femoris in Montpellier, on February 1 (1-3), and initially announced out of three weeks, Mbappé had returned to the grounds of the Camp des Loges on Sunday, for the race, collective work with those who have little or not played at Louis II and a few strikes. To see if Bondy’s crack participated in the entire session on Monday. To see especially how he reacts to the session of the day. Christophe Galtier should give some details on this subject later this Monday, at a press conference (5:30 p.m.), but the chances of seeing him in the group on Tuesday are increasing hour by hour…
